The document covers the concept of derivatives in calculus, focusing on illustrating the tangent line to a function at specific points. It explains how to find the derivative using limits and provides examples of calculating the derivative and the equation of tangent lines for various functions. Key definitions and notations related to derivatives are also included.

WeekDefinition of the Derivative of a Function
4 m=

𝑓 (𝑥+h)− 𝑓 (𝑥)
𝑓 ′(𝑥 )=lim
h →0 h
f ’(x) symbol for derivative (read “f prime of x” )
f ’(x) means first derivative
f ’’(x) means second derivative
